Output c143c2aeb02ea888604d8dc3db5e1f2584752a9e9048155ed771b3493b4a6871:8

value
26695943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ab8ab81a1553e629bdc5fea85a651c25e7e9b21 OP_EQUAL
address
MLYehzhZ5Ajpy56c1APbxCZpN1iYzeuRPu
transaction
c143c2aeb02ea888604d8dc3db5e1f2584752a9e9048155ed771b3493b4a6871
spent
true